WebJan 20, 2024 · Theta Notation (Represented as θ) Let f (n) f (n) and g (n) g(n) be two functions dependent on the input variable n. So, the function f (n) = θ (g (n)) if there exists some positive constants c1, c2 c1,c2 and n' n′ such that c1.g (n) <= f (n) <= c2.g (n) c1.g(n) <= f (n) <= c2.g(n) for all n >= n' n >= n′. WebAs long as these constants k_1 k1 and k_2 k2 exist, we say that the running time is \Theta (n) Θ(n). We are not restricted to just n n in big-Θ notation. We can use any function, such as n^2 n2, n \log_2 n nlog2n, or any other function of n n.
